        hey rahul!! Did you test drive the bike?? I wanted to suggest you since long that get a test drive as and when you can.. The reason i suggest you this is because you once said you dont ride the bike above 40-50kmph anytime.. Now what i find riding the cbr for about 3weeks is, this bike needs a lot of working the clutch and gears at low speeds (ie. Speeds <50). There is torque present everywhere.. But the bike either knocks at an upper gear or feels stressed at a gear lower.. the point is i dint find it comfortable doing low speeds.. on a highway.. On 6th gear.. Minimum is 80kmph and if you wanna cruise below that, need to get on a lower gear.. I hope you understand what i meant to say.. I posted this for you as i remembered your previous words on your ride habbits i have no intention to spoil your mood to buy the cbr.. Its a great bike.. But just get a nice test ride to see if it suits your purpose.. Or its waist spending that extra money and burning the extra fuel.. Else the bike is awesome.. (but very difficult to keep clean)..

            • @metal_maniac: Now what i find riding the cbr for about 3weeks is, this bike needs a lot of working the clutch and gears at low speeds (ie. Speeds <50). There is torque present everywhere.. But the bike either knocks at an upper gear or feels stressed at a gear lower.. the point is i dint find it comfortable doing low speeds.. on a highway.. On 6th gear.. Minimum is 80kmph and if you wanna cruise below that, need to get on a lower gear..
              Thanks bro, this is vital information for people who are giving thought to CBR as a daily commute and plan to ride at low speeds. I guess the engine is designed for hi-revs, so it will obviously show the signs as you mentioned like knocking, stress etc.
              I am surely gonna give a second thought as vadodara roads/traffic dont allow you to go above 60 max and there is hardly any place more than 10-15 kms apart, unless you plan to go out of the city. (Maybe Yammy will fit the criteria well )
